| Experience / Brief Profle | Mr. Karnam Sekar is a professional Banker with rich experience in all the facets of Indian Companying at a very senior level. He joined as a Probatonary Ofcer with State Bank of India in 1983 and rose to the level of Deputy Managing Director. Selected as Managing Director of Public Sector Bank and has the rare distncton of heading two public Sector Banks during very critcal juncture of their history. As the Dy MD of SBI, he contributed during the Board level deliberatons of the Naton’s Largest Commercial Bank for more than four years. He also acted operated as nominee director on the Boards of Clearing Corporaton of India Ltd, Natonal e-Governance Services Ltd (NeSL) etc. |
Mr. Hemant Bhargava is a Master’s in economics. Mr. Bhargava joined LIC as a direct recruit ofcer in 1981 and retred as its Managing Director in July 2019. During his long tenure of 38 years, he worked across diverse set of roles both in India and abroad, building mult-dimensional experience in diferent capacites, especially in Marketng, Internal Operatons, and new ventures. He was the frst chief of LIC Internatonal Operatons SBU, besides being instrumental in setng up LIC Cards Services Limited. His tenure as Managing Director (and also as Chairman in-charge from January to March 2019) was marked by his creatve leadership with new ideas enriched by the extensive experience gained in overseeing several functons including Marketng, Finance, Personnel, Investments, Alternatve Channel, etc. Presently he is on the Board of Larsen and Toubro and Tata Power Company Limited and ITC. |
Mrs. Smita Aggarwal is listed in “Top 35 Global Women in Fintech Powerlist”, ‘Top Women in Finance’, “Top 30 Fintech Infuencers” and “Women Who Venture”, Mrs. Aggarwal is a fntech investor and a thought leader with deep expertse in venture capital, fnancial inclusion, digital banking, micro-insurance and fnancial regulaton. She is Global Investments Advisor for Flourish Ventures, a global fntech focussed fund, and leads investments in innovatve fntech start-ups that help advance fnancial health and inclusion in Asia. She is on the Fintech Advisory Board of New York University and Global Fintech Fest. She is a member of the Board of Directors of IIFL Asset Management Company. She is a guest faculty for “Fintech in Emerging Markets” at the Stern School of Business, New York University. She has three decades of experience in fnance as a banker, lender, regulator and an investor that have enriched her with unparalleled domain expertse, unique perspectve and empathy for fntech founders. She has held leadership positons with noteworthy names such as Omidyar Network, Fullerton India Credit, Reserve Bank of India and ICICI Bank with a successful track record of building businesses from scratch, introducing new products, and driving growth through innovaton. She is a rank-holder chartered accountant and has atended executve programs at Harvard Business School and MIT Sloan School of Management. |

Item No. 4:
The Company has put in place the employee stock option scheme namely ‘CSL Employee Stock Option Scheme 2017’ (“Scheme”). The said Scheme was approved by the Board of Directors on 31[st] December, 2017 and by the Shareholders on 7[th] May, 2018 (Result of which was declared on 9[th] May, 2018) and ratified by the Shareholders in Extra-ordinary General Meeting held on 18[th] September, 2018. The stock options granted to employees under the said Scheme were initially expected to vest in two tranches as under:
(a) First Tranche
Half of the Options Granted to an employee shall vest in equal instalments over a period of 3 (three) years on the first, second and third anniversary of the Grant Date.
- (b) Second Tranche
The remaining 50% of the total grant is dependent on UGRO Capital Limited achieving Asset Under Management (AUM) and Return on Asset (ROA) as mentioned in the Scheme during FY 2022 and 2023 (“Old Vesting Conditions”). However, considering the disruptions caused by the pandemic of COVID-19, it is less likely that the Company will achieve the vesting conditions which are linked with AUM and ROA contained in the Scheme and accordingly, in order to protect the interest of the grantees, the Company has re-examined the Scheme particularly the Vesting Conditions with intent that the interest of employees is not adversely affected and the essence or desire to do better is not also taken away.
In view of the above, the Board of Directors of the Company after recommendation of the Nomination and Remuneration Committee has introduced a new vesting condition under the Scheme which is linked with internal rate of return (IRR) which means internal rate of return
calculated on vesting price to the average traded price as more particularly defined in the Scheme. Employees shall be able to exercise the options only when the Company achieves the IRR between 15% to 22.5%. Depending upon IRR achieved employees shall be able to exercise the options on proportionate basis in the following manner and as per the terms of the revised Scheme:
(i) First Tranche: 50% of the total option granted shall vest during the period starting from 1[st] April, 2023 - 31[st ] March, 2024 on a quarterly basis i.e. 30[th] June, 2023, 30[th] September, 2023, 31[st] December, 2023 and 31[st] March, 2024;
(ii) Second Tranche: 50% of the total option granted shall vest during the period starting from 1[st ] April, 2025 - 31[st ] March, 2026 on a quarterly basis i.e. 30[th] June, 2025, 30[th] September, 2025, 31[st] December, 2025 and 31[st] March, 2026.
Explanation : In case the IRR as at the Vesting date is between 15% to 22.5%, the number of options that can be exercised will be proportionate to the IRR generated and as per the illustration table as detailed in the Scheme. Further, in case the IRR is less than 22.5% as on First Tranche vesting date, the ineligible portion shall be added to the total exercisable options in Second Tranche. The total eligible options in Second Tranche shall then be determined by the IRR as on the Second Tranche vesting date as per the illustration table as detailed in the Scheme.
Under the revised Scheme, employees who have been granted options that, in case he/she wish to opt out of the New Vesting Conditions he/she can continue with the Old Vesting Conditions as provided in the Scheme.
Further, pursuant to Regulation 9(4) and 9(5) of SEBI (Share Based Employee Benefits and Sweat Equity) Regulations, 2021, in case the employee suffers a permanent incapacity while in employment or in the event of death of the employee while in employment, all the stock options or any other benefit granted to such employee under the Scheme shall vest on that day when such event occurs.
Keeping in view the above provisions, it is proposed to modify Clause 9.3 (2) and (3) of the Scheme in the following manner:
